How Many Points Is Speeding in Missouri?
Missouri speeding tickets don’t just come with a fine — they come with points, and points are what put your license at risk.
This article explains how many points Missouri assigns for speeding, how those points add up, and why Kansas City drivers often underestimate the danger.
Missouri Speeding Point Breakdown
Common point values include:
Minor speeding → 2 points
Higher-speed violations → 3–4 points
Serious or repeat violations → more
Points are assessed per conviction, not per stop.
Why These Points Matter
Points don’t reset each time you get a ticket.
They stack — and once you hit certain thresholds, Missouri takes action automatically.
This is how routine tickets quietly turn into suspensions.
Real Kansas City Example
A driver who:
Pays two routine speeding tickets in a year
Receives 3 points each time
Now has 6 points — already halfway to suspension territory.
Most drivers don’t realize this until it’s too late.
How Drivers Accidentally Lock in Points
Points are usually locked in when:
You pay the ticket
You fight and lose
You miss deadlines and default
